NEW YORK, September 23, 2022 /PRNewswire/ — The World market for telehandlers is fragmented in nature. The market is highly competitive and is dominated by suppliers such as JC Bamford Excavators, Manitou and Oshkosh. Most of the leading providers in the market are headquartered in Europe. Established suppliers are focused on increasing the lifting capacity and height of their existing models. They also focus on improving control systems to increase security, which is a major concern and differentiating factor for buyers. In addition, vendors are developing a wide range of products to expand their portfolio for various end-user applications and increase profitability. Technavio anticipates that the global telehandler market will continue to grow $1.73 billionAccelerating at a CAGR of 5.66% over the forecast period.
Significant investments are made in the construction of oil and gas pipelines worldwide. This is evident in developing countries such as the US and Canada because of the shale gas boom. These countries are also making huge investments in public infrastructure, increasing demand for telehandlers. Also, the recent crackdown on illegal immigration by the US government has resulted in a shortage of farm workers in the country. This has prompted the agricultural sector in the US to focus on mechanization of farming and ranching. Many of these factors are expected to create significant opportunities for vendors during the forecast period.
Technavio segments the global telehandler market by Application (Construction, Agriculture, Industrial and Others) and Geography (APAC, North America, Europe, South Americaand the middle East and Africa).
The construction industry will have the largest market share during the forecast period. The growth of the residential and commercial construction market is leading to a significant demand for telescopic handlers in the construction industry. The increasing use of modular construction will further accelerate the growth of the market in the construction segment.
From a regional perspective, APAC will emerge as a key market, taking 45% of the global market share. Increasing investment in infrastructure projects such as transportation and energy in countries China, Indiaand Japan drive the growth of the regional market.
The market is driven by the increasing need for bulk material handling in agriculture and livestock.
